Flood Watch issued June 4 at 11:00PM MDT until June 5 at 6:00PM MDT by NWS Albuquerque NM * WHAT...Flash flooding caused by excessive rainfall continues to be possible. * WHERE...The South Central Mountains, including the Ruidoso area burn scars. * WHEN...Friday afternoon. * IMPACTS...Excessive runoff may result in flooding of rivers, creeks, streams, and other low-lying and flood-prone locations.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- Slow-moving thunderstorms Friday afternoon will be capable of producing heavy rainfall rates in excess of one inch per hour, which could create rapid runoff and debris flows downstream of burn scars. - Areas on and downstream of the South Fork and Salt burn scars in Ruidoso and the Seven Cabins burn scar in the Capitan Mountains.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ood You should monitor later forecasts and be prepared to take action should Flash Flood Warnings be issued.
